The Drum Major was considered the Leader of the Marine Band, while the Fife Major's responsibility was to train the fifers.The first leader of the United States Marine Band was William Farr, listed in historical records as having served as Drum Major from January 21, 1799. Founded in 1798 by an Act of Congress, the Marine Band is America's oldest continuously active professional musical organization.
